Marine engines and propulsion systems are dense, awkward, and often high-value, so trailer choice has to match the load profile. Depending on height, center of gravity, and axle loading, we may use RGNs, lowboys, step decks, double drops, or multi-axle trailers. A lowboy can help reduce overall deck height for taller engine assemblies, while an RGN can make loading and positioning easier for oversized crates or framed machinery. Step decks work well when the cargo needs extra deck length but still has height sensitivity. Multi-axle setups spread weight for heavier propulsion packages and help manage bridge and pavement limits. Heavy Haul Transporting reviews dimensions, cradle points, and securement needs before dispatch. Heavy Haulers also look at whether the shipment needs extra clearance for exhaust towers, control modules, or attached skids. For marine cargo, blocking, chain placement, and load balance are just as important as the trailer itself. That is how the move stays under control on the highway.
California oversize permits can involve more than a simple approval. Route planning must account for axle weights, overall width, height, and length, plus local restrictions near Eureka and the road network leaving Port of Humboldt Bay, CA. We study access to US-101, CA-255, and nearby connectors before dispatch, then check bridge clearances, turning radii, and construction zones that could affect a heavy move. For taller marine engines or propulsion assemblies, height becomes the first issue; for heavier units, axle distribution and pavement limits matter just as much. Depending on the load, escorts may be required, and some moves need route surveys before departure. Heavy Haulers coordinate those steps with the permit plan so the truck does not get boxed in by a low bridge or a tight curve. Marine engines and propulsion systems are dense, sensitive to shifting, and often built around unusual dimensions. They can include skids, shafts, gearboxes, or control assemblies that change the load shape. That makes trailer selection, securement, and route planning more detailed than standard freight moves.
